Transaction 74d8288768cae510a79efb6c1c754fd857dc84a2114b3b63cd948f97ee2ce51a
1 Input
1 Output
-
74d8288768cae510a79efb6c1c754fd857dc84a2114b3b63cd948f97ee2ce51a:0
- value
- 4999175
- script pubkey
- OP_0 OP_PUSHBYTES_20 0878c11ffa4174030b76d9a70d0e2b3e02f1de83
- address
- bc1qppuvz8l6g96qxzmkmxns6r3t8cp0rh5r7wrcxl